What types of jobs are available at Hillcrest Medical Center Tulsa?

Hillcrest Medical Center offers a diverse range of job opportunities to suit various skills and experience levels. These roles span across numerous departments and specialties, including but not limited to:

  • Nursing: Registered Nurses (RNs), Licensed Practical Nurses (LPNs), Certified Nursing Assistants (CNAs), Nurse Managers, and specialized nursing roles (e.g., ICU, ER, Oncology).
  • Medical: Physicians, Physician Assistants (PAs), Medical Assistants, Technicians (lab, radiology, respiratory), and other allied health professionals.
  • Administrative: Receptionists, Medical Secretaries, Billing Specialists, Human Resources, and other administrative support staff.
  • Support Services: Environmental Services, Food Services, Security, and other support roles crucial for hospital operations.

What is the application process like at Hillcrest Medical Center?

The application process usually involves several stages:

  1. Online Application: Submitting your application through the online portal.
  2. Screening: Your application will be reviewed by the hiring manager to assess if your qualifications meet the basic requirements.
  3. Interview: If selected, you'll be invited for one or more interviews with members of the hiring team. This may include behavioral questions, technical questions related to the role, and opportunities for you to ask questions.
  4. Background Check and References: Successful candidates will undergo background checks and reference checks.
  5. Offer of Employment: If everything checks out, you will receive a formal job offer.

The exact process may vary depending on the specific position and department.

Does Hillcrest Medical Center offer benefits to its employees?

Yes, Hillcrest Medical Center generally provides a comprehensive benefits package to its eligible employees. These benefits typically include:

  • Health Insurance: Medical, dental, and vision insurance.
  • Retirement Plan: A retirement savings plan, often with employer matching contributions.
  • Paid Time Off: Vacation time, sick leave, and possibly other paid time off options.
  • Life Insurance: Life insurance coverage.
  • Disability Insurance: Short-term and long-term disability insurance.
